* Name: sam_configinput
*
* Description:
* Configure a GPIO input pin based on bit-encoded description of the pin.
*
****************************************************************************/
static inline int sam_configinput(uintptr_t base, uint32_t pin,
gpio_pinset_t cfgset)
{
#ifdef GPIO_HAVE_SCHMITT
uint32_t regval;
#endif
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_IDR_OFFSET);
if ((cfgset & GPIO_CFG_PULLUP) != 0)
{
#ifdef GPIO_HAVE_PULLDOWN
* active. Therefore, we need to disable the pull-down first before
* enabling the pull-up.
*/
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PPDDR_OFFSET);
#endif
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PUER_OFFSET);
}
else
{
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PUDR_OFFSET);
}
#ifdef GPIO_HAVE_PULLDOWN
if ((cfgset & GPIO_CFG_PULLDOWN) != 0)
{
* active. Therefore, we need to disable the pull-up first before
* enabling the pull-down.
*/
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PUDR_OFFSET);
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PPDER_OFFSET);
}
else
{
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PPDDR_OFFSET);
}
#endif
if ((cfgset & GPIO_CFG_DEGLITCH) != 0)
{
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_IFER_OFFSET);
}
else
{
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_IFDR_OFFSET);
}
#ifdef GPIO_HAVE_SCHMITT
regval = getreg32(base + SAM_PIO_SCHMITT_OFFSET);
if ((cfgset & GPIO_CFG_PULLDOWN) != 0)
{
regval |= pin;
}
else
{
regval &= ~pin;
}
putreg32(regval, base + SAM_PIO_SCHMITT_OFFSET);
#endif
#ifdef GPIO_HAVE_DRIVER
regval = getreg32(base + SAM_PIO_DRIVER_OFFSET);
regval &= ~pin;
putreg32(regval, base + SAM_PIO_DRIVER_OFFSET);
#endif
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_ODR_OFFSET);
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PER_OFFSET);
* IFDGSR registers. This would probably best be done with
* another, new API... perhaps sam_configfilter()
*/
return OK;
}
* Name: sam_configoutput
*
* Description:
* Configure a GPIO output pin based on bit-encoded description of the pin.
*
****************************************************************************/
static inline int sam_configoutput(uintptr_t base, uint32_t pin,
gpio_pinset_t cfgset)
{
#ifdef GPIO_HAVE_DRIVER
uint32_t regval;
#endif
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_IDR_OFFSET);
if ((cfgset & GPIO_CFG_PULLUP) != 0)
{
#ifdef GPIO_HAVE_PULLDOWN
* active. Therefore, we need to disable the pull-down first before
* enabling the pull-up.
*/
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PPDDR_OFFSET);
#endif
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PUER_OFFSET);
}
else
{
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PUDR_OFFSET);
}
#ifdef GPIO_HAVE_PULLDOWN
if ((cfgset & GPIO_CFG_PULLDOWN) != 0)
{
* active. Therefore, we need to disable the pull-up first before
* enabling the pull-down.
*/
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PUDR_OFFSET);
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PPDER_OFFSET);
}
else
{
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PPDDR_OFFSET);
}
#endif
if ((cfgset & GPIO_CFG_OPENDRAIN) != 0)
{
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_MDER_OFFSET);
}
else
{
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_MDDR_OFFSET);
}
if ((cfgset & GPIO_OUTPUT_SET) != 0)
{
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_SODR_OFFSET);
}
else
{
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_CODR_OFFSET);
}
#ifdef GPIO_HAVE_DRIVER
regval = getreg32(base + SAM_PIO_DRIVER_OFFSET);
if ((cfgset & GPIO_OUTPUT_DRIVE) != GPIO_OUTPUT_LOW_DRIVE)
{
regval |= pin;
}
else
{
regval &= ~pin;
}
putreg32(regval, base + SAM_PIO_DRIVER_OFFSET);
#endif
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_OER_OFFSET);
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PER_OFFSET);
return OK;
}
* Name: sam_configperiph
*
* Description:
* Configure a GPIO pin driven by a peripheral A or B signal based on
* bit-encoded description of the pin.
*
****************************************************************************/
static inline int sam_configperiph(uintptr_t base, uint32_t pin,
gpio_pinset_t cfgset)
{
uint32_t regval;
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_IDR_OFFSET);
if ((cfgset & GPIO_CFG_PULLUP) != 0)
{
#ifdef GPIO_HAVE_PULLDOWN
* active. Therefore, we need to disable the pull-down first before
* enabling the pull-up.
*/
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PPDDR_OFFSET);
#endif
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PUER_OFFSET);
}
else
{
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PUDR_OFFSET);
}
#ifdef GPIO_HAVE_PULLDOWN
if ((cfgset & GPIO_CFG_PULLDOWN) != 0)
{
* active. Therefore, we need to disable the pull-up first before
* enabling the pull-down.
*/
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PUDR_OFFSET);
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PPDER_OFFSET);
}
else
{
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PPDDR_OFFSET);
}
#endif
#ifdef GPIO_HAVE_DRIVER
regval = getreg32(base + SAM_PIO_DRIVER_OFFSET);
regval &= ~pin;
putreg32(regval, base + SAM_PIO_DRIVER_OFFSET);
#endif
#ifdef GPIO_HAVE_PERIPHCD
*
* PERIPHA: ABCDSR1[n] = 0 ABCDSR2[n] = 0
* PERIPHB: ABCDSR1[n] = 1 ABCDSR2[n] = 0
* PERIPHC: ABCDSR1[n] = 0 ABCDSR2[n] = 1
* PERIPHD: ABCDSR1[n] = 1 ABCDSR2[n] = 1
*/
regval = getreg32(base + SAM_PIO_ABCDSR1_OFFSET);
if ((cfgset & GPIO_MODE_MASK) == GPIO_PERIPHA ||
(cfgset & GPIO_MODE_MASK) == GPIO_PERIPHC)
{
regval &= ~pin;
}
else
{
regval |= pin;
}
putreg32(regval, base + SAM_PIO_ABCDSR1_OFFSET);
regval = getreg32(base + SAM_PIO_ABCDSR2_OFFSET);
if ((cfgset & GPIO_MODE_MASK) == GPIO_PERIPHA ||
(cfgset & GPIO_MODE_MASK) == GPIO_PERIPHB)
{
regval &= ~pin;
}
else
{
regval |= pin;
}
putreg32(regval, base + SAM_PIO_ABCDSR2_OFFSET);
#else
*
* PERIPHA: ABSR[n] = 0
* PERIPHB: ABSR[n] = 1
*/
regval = getreg32(base + SAM_PIO_ABSR_OFFSET);
if ((cfgset & GPIO_MODE_MASK) == GPIO_PERIPHA)
{
regval &= ~pin;
}
else
{
regval |= pin;
}
putreg32(regval, base + SAM_PIO_ABSR_OFFSET);
#endif
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_PDR_OFFSET);
return OK;
}

* Name: sam_configgpio
*
* Description:
* Configure a GPIO pin based on bit-encoded description of the pin.
*
****************************************************************************/
int sam_configgpio(gpio_pinset_t cfgset)
{
uintptr_t base = sam_gpio_base(cfgset);
uint32_t pin = sam_gpio_pinmask(cfgset);
irqstate_t flags;
int ret;
flags = spin_lock_irqsave(&g_configgpio_lock);
putreg32(PIO_WPMR_WPKEY, base + SAM_PIO_WPMR_OFFSET);
switch (cfgset & GPIO_MODE_MASK)
{
case GPIO_ALTERNATE:
case GPIO_INPUT:
ret = sam_configinput(base, pin, cfgset);
break;
case GPIO_OUTPUT:
ret = sam_configoutput(base, pin, cfgset);
break;
case GPIO_PERIPHA:
case GPIO_PERIPHB:
#ifdef GPIO_HAVE_PERIPHCD
case GPIO_PERIPHC:
case GPIO_PERIPHD:
#endif
ret = sam_configperiph(base, pin, cfgset);
break;
default:
ret = -EINVAL;
break;
}
putreg32(PIO_WPMR_WPEN | PIO_WPMR_WPKEY, base + SAM_PIO_WPMR_OFFSET);
spin_unlock_irqrestore(&g_configgpio_lock, flags);
return ret;
}
* Name: sam_gpiowrite
*
* Description:
* Write one or zero to the selected GPIO pin
*
****************************************************************************/
void sam_gpiowrite(gpio_pinset_t pinset, bool value)
{
uintptr_t base = sam_gpio_base(pinset);
uint32_t pin = sam_gpio_pinmask(pinset);
if (value)
{
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_SODR_OFFSET);
}
else
{
putreg32(pin, base + SAM_PIO_CODR_OFFSET);
}
}
* Name: sam_gpioread
*
* Description:
* Read one or zero from the selected GPIO pin
*
****************************************************************************/
bool sam_gpioread(gpio_pinset_t pinset)
{
uintptr_t base = sam_gpio_base(pinset);
uint32_t pin = sam_gpio_pinmask(pinset);
uint32_t regval;
* Output pin will not be read back correctly.
*/
regval = getreg32(base + SAM_PIO_PDSR_OFFSET);
return (regval & pin) != 0;
}
